Method: Mongoid::Errors::Validations#initialize

Defined in:
lib/mongoid/errors/validations.rb

#initialize(document) ⇒ Validations

Returns a new instance of Validations.



14
15
16
17
18
19
20
21
22
23
24
25
26
# File 'lib/mongoid/errors/validations.rb', line 14

def initialize(document)
  @document = document

  super(
    compose_message(
      "validations",
      {
        document: document.class,
        errors: document.errors.full_messages.join(", ")
      }
    )
  )
end